What companies run services between Blackness, Dundee City, Scotland and Linlithgow, Scotland?

ScotRail operates a train from Dundee to Linlithgow once daily. Tickets cost £15–27 and the journey takes 1h 28m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Nethergate to Cross via Queensferry Street and Shandwick Place in around 2h 38m.
